
Szabolcs Hegyi
Szabolcs Hegyi is a lawyer with the Hungarian Civil Liberties Union (TASZ), who has spoken out against recent government actions that he believes undermine equal rights for LGBTQ+ citizens in Hungary. Hegyi argues that attempts to restrict information about sexual orientation and LGBTQ+ issues are discriminatory and contrary to human rights.
